Output 2618948a65efcbd3e1a9f069a41108875d35277da5d02ef1b11b208e7ca40994:0

value
88003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f2e7f1b571f8aea78e296eba5a111a8b1e7048 OP_EQUALVERIFY OP_CHECKSIG
address
1DDFrvPK2kGjEd9D1RTcSWCMm82PMLjF66
transaction
2618948a65efcbd3e1a9f069a41108875d35277da5d02ef1b11b208e7ca40994
spent
true